This latest rumor comes from TechCrunch which claims to have the logs from an app that was tested with an iOS 5 device, presumably the iPhone 5. The device supposedly used mobile network codes and mobile country codes from both Verizon and AT&T.
While having one iPhone to rule them all would be fantastic, this feature may or may not pan out. Apple could easily scrap the idea of a world phone at the last minute. It’s not that hard to do. Just look at the Verizon iPhone 4. It has a dual-mode Qualcomm chip, but its GSM capability is not turned on. [TechCrunch]
